Compartir a través de


ListViewBase.ScrollIntoView Método

Definición

Sobrecargas

ScrollIntoView(Object, ScrollIntoViewAlignment)

Desplaza la lista para que el elemento de datos especificado se vea con la alineación especificada.

ScrollIntoView(Object)

Desplaza la lista para que el elemento de datos especificado se vea.

ScrollIntoView(Object, ScrollIntoViewAlignment)

Desplaza la lista para que el elemento de datos especificado se vea con la alineación especificada.

public:
 virtual void ScrollIntoView(Platform::Object ^ item, ScrollIntoViewAlignment alignment) = ScrollIntoView;
/// [Windows.Foundation.Metadata.Overload("ScrollIntoViewWithAlignment")]
void ScrollIntoView(IInspectable const& item, ScrollIntoViewAlignment const& alignment);
[Windows.Foundation.Metadata.Overload("ScrollIntoViewWithAlignment")]
public void ScrollIntoView(object item, ScrollIntoViewAlignment alignment);
function scrollIntoView(item, alignment)
Public Sub ScrollIntoView (item As Object, alignment As ScrollIntoViewAlignment)

Parámetros

item
Object

Platform::Object

IInspectable

Elemento de datos que se va a incluir en la vista.

alignment
ScrollIntoViewAlignment

Valor de enumeración que especifica si el elemento usa predeterminado o alineación de inicial.

Atributos

Ejemplos

Puede encontrar un ejemplo completo centrado en cómo usar ScrollIntoView aquí.

Comentarios

El método ScrollIntoView se usa para mostrar un elemento cuando el control ListViewBase no se usa como vista en un control SemanticZoom de . Para incluir un elemento en la vista cuando el control listViewBase de se usa en un SemanticZoom, use el método MakeVisible en su lugar.

Cuando cambia el contenido de ItemsSource colección, especialmente si se agregan o quitan muchos elementos de la colección, es posible que tenga que llamar a UpdateLayout antes de llamar a ScrollIntoView para que el elemento especificado se desplácese hasta la ventanilla.

Consulte también

Se aplica a

ScrollIntoView(Object)

Desplaza la lista para que el elemento de datos especificado se vea.

public:
 virtual void ScrollIntoView(Platform::Object ^ item) = ScrollIntoView;
/// [Windows.Foundation.Metadata.Overload("ScrollIntoView")]
void ScrollIntoView(IInspectable const& item);
[Windows.Foundation.Metadata.Overload("ScrollIntoView")]
public void ScrollIntoView(object item);
function scrollIntoView(item)
Public Sub ScrollIntoView (item As Object)

Parámetros

item
Object

Platform::Object

IInspectable

Elemento de datos que se va a incluir en la vista.

Atributos

Comentarios

Use el método ScrollIntoView para mostrar un elemento cuando el control ListViewBase no se usa como vista en un control SemanticZoom. Para incluir un elemento en la vista cuando el control listViewBase de se usa en un SemanticZoom, use el método MakeVisible en su lugar.

Cuando cambia el contenido de la colección itemsSource , especialmente si se agregan o quitan muchos elementos de la colección, es posible que deba llamar a UpdateLayout antes de llamar a ScrollIntoView para que el elemento especificado se desplácese hacia la ventanilla.

Consulte también

Se aplica a